Output 51c6141de0c5fb38c49705588768d7feb01b5d80ec2ee82c1342d301d4a61af0:9

value
134578
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d29068773497fe0e701a9392585afc7f69a613d1 OP_EQUALVERIFY OP_CHECKSIG
address
1LCMtw7LiKjMYt7FsfbksyjySLZyWpwsSx
transaction
51c6141de0c5fb38c49705588768d7feb01b5d80ec2ee82c1342d301d4a61af0
spent
true